🚑 What to Do If You Notice These Signs
If you or someone else experiences these symptoms:
- Seek medical help immediately
- Do not wait for symptoms to go away
- Call emergency services
Time is critical when dealing with a stroke.
🧠 Remember the FAST Rule
A simple way to recognize stroke symptoms quickly:
- F – Face drooping
- A – Arm weakness
- S – Speech difficulty
- T – Time to call for help
